A 100pt beauty from the result of a sunny, extraordinary vintage. This is the second most concentrated Yquem after 1945, according to the winemaker, with about 160 grams of residual sugar. Approachable now, should sing in five or six years, but will live forever.

Tasting notes

Lots of botrytis, with turmeric, saffron, cream, roasted meringue, pine nuts, spices and dried mangoes. This is a powerful, seductive and lush wine with so much charm and harmony. Long and spicy, with a hint of petrol at the end. Extraordinary.

Expert review

A solid and powerful structure with aromas that reveal intense botrytised notes – the hallmark of high-quality noble rot. Candied lemon and pear, as well as orange marmalade, delicate florals of lime blossom and frangipane mingle with this fruitiness, enhanced by the sweetness of blooming lily of the valley. The almond and gourmand nose foreshadows wonderful richness on the palate. Starting out lively with candied fruit flavours, 2022 Château d’Yquem is resolutely reminiscent of apricot jam. Rich and concentrated, it coats the palate, revealing notes of beeswax, caramel and quince paste. Its powdery texture is prolonged by a touch of salinity and lovely bitter notes on the finish, which enhance the candied bitter orange characteristic of Yquem. wines
